What Most People Get Wrong

A lot of builders assume:

β€œBigger injectors automatically mean more performance.”

That is only partially true.

If injectors are inconsistent from cylinder to cylinder, the engine can experience:

  • Uneven combustion
  • Lean cylinders
  • Rich cylinders
  • Tuning instability
  • Rough idle
  • Inconsistent power delivery

The injector size might be correct β€” but the fueling balance may still be wrong.

What Flow Matching Actually Means

Flow matching is the process of testing injectors and grouping them so their fuel delivery characteristics stay extremely close to each other.

This includes:

  • Static flow testing
  • Dynamic flow testing
  • Spray pattern consistency
  • Electrical response verification

The goal is to reduce cylinder-to-cylinder fuel variation.

Why This Matters on Performance Builds

Performance engines operate closer to their limits.

That means fueling inconsistencies become more dangerous as:

  • Boost increases
  • RPM increases
  • E85 usage increases
  • Cylinder pressure rises

A single lean cylinder can create major engine problems under load.

Why E85 Makes Flow Matching More Important

E85 requires significantly more fuel volume than gasoline.

That means:

  • Injectors work harder
  • Duty cycle increases
  • Fuel demand rises quickly

If injectors are inconsistent, E85 setups can expose those weaknesses faster than pump gas builds.

How Injector Quality Affects Tuning

Many tuning problems are actually fueling consistency problems.

When injectors behave differently from cylinder to cylinder, the tuner must compensate for inconsistencies the ECU cannot fully correct.

A cleaner injector set helps create:

  • More stable fuel trims
  • Better drivability
  • Improved idle quality
  • More predictable boost behavior
